-
- Downloads
cgraph.c (cgraph_clone_edge): New UPDATE_ORIGINAL argument.
* cgraph.c (cgraph_clone_edge): New UPDATE_ORIGINAL argument. (cgraph_clone_node): Likewise. * cgraph.h (cgraph_clone_edge): Update prototype. (cgraph_clone_node): Likewise. * ipa-inline.c (cgraph_clone_inlined_nodes): Update call of cgraph_clone_node. (lookup_recursive_calls): Consider profile. (cgraph_decide_recursive_inlining): Fix updating; use new probability argument; use profile. * params.def (PARAM_MIN_INLINE_RECURSIVE_PROBABILITY): New. * tree-inline.c (copy_bb): Update clal of clone_edge. * tree-optimize.c (tree_rest_of_compilation): UPdate cal of clone_node. * invoke.texi (min-inline-recursive-probability): Document. From-SVN: r102521
Showing
- gcc/ChangeLog 17 additions, 0 deletionsgcc/ChangeLog
- gcc/cgraph.c 15 additions, 6 deletionsgcc/cgraph.c
- gcc/cgraph.h 5 additions, 2 deletionsgcc/cgraph.h
- gcc/doc/invoke.texi 12 additions, 0 deletionsgcc/doc/invoke.texi
- gcc/ipa-inline.c 55 additions, 14 deletionsgcc/ipa-inline.c
- gcc/params.def 5 additions, 0 deletionsgcc/params.def
- gcc/tree-inline.c 1 addition, 1 deletiongcc/tree-inline.c
- gcc/tree-optimize.c 1 addition, 1 deletiongcc/tree-optimize.c
Loading
Please register or sign in to comment